Question 1
Which expression correctly represents the domain using interval notation for all real
numbers except two excluded points?
A. (−∞, ∞)
B. (−∞, x) ∪ (z, ∞)
C. [−∞, ∞]
D. (x, z)
Correct Answer: B. (−∞, x) ∪ (z, ∞)
Rationale: Interval notation for domains with excluded values uses unions of open
intervals, excluding specific points where the function is undefined. Option A
incorrectly includes all real numbers, while C is invalid since infinity cannot be
bracketed. Option D restricts values instead of excluding them.
Question 2
Which notation indicates that an endpoint is not included in an interval?
A. [ ]
B. ( )
C. { }
D. | |
Correct Answer: B. ( )
Rationale: Parentheses indicate exclusion of endpoints in interval notation. Brackets
include endpoints, while braces are used for sets and absolute value symbols are
unrelated to interval notation.
Question 3

Which algebraic condition defines symmetry about the y-axis?
A. f(x) = −f(x)
B. f(x) = f(−x)
C. f(−x) = −f(x)
D. f(x) = x
Correct Answer: B. f(x) = f(−x)
Rationale: A function is symmetric about the y-axis if replacing x with −x produces
the same output. The other options describe odd functions or unrelated conditions.
Question 4
A function has symmetry about the origin if:
A. f(x) = f(−x)
B. f(−x) = −f(x)
C. f(x) = 0
D. f(x) = x²
Correct Answer: B. f(−x) = −f(x)
Rationale: Origin symmetry defines odd functions where input sign reversal changes
output sign. The other options do not represent origin symmetry.
Question 5
Which statement correctly describes a point discontinuity?
A. The graph approaches infinity
B. A hole exists at a single point
C. The graph is smooth
D. The function is linear
Correct Answer: B. A hole exists at a single point
Rationale: Point discontinuity occurs when a function is undefined at a specific x-
value, creating a hole. Other options describe different behaviors or function types.
Question 6
What is the correct definition of an infinite discontinuity?
A. A single missing point
B. A graph that continues smoothly

C. Function values grow without bound
D. A horizontal line
Correct Answer: C. Function values grow without bound
Rationale: Infinite discontinuity occurs when a function approaches ±∞ near a vertical
asymptote. Other options do not describe asymptotic behavior.
Question 7
Average rate of change is best described as:
A. Area under curve
B. Slope of a secant line
C. Maximum value
D. Integral value
Correct Answer: B. Slope of a secant line
Rationale: Average rate of change measures how a function changes over an interval,
similar to slope between two points. The other options describe unrelated calculus
concepts.
Question 8
A positive average rate of change indicates:
A. Decrease in function
B. Constant function
C. Interval of increase
D. No change
Correct Answer: C. Interval of increase
Rationale: A positive slope indicates the function is increasing over that interval.
Negative values indicate decrease.
